Learn Dart

50+
Λήψεις
Αξιολόγηση περιεχομένου
Κατάλληλο για όλους
Εικόνα στιγμιότυπου οθόνης
Εικόνα στιγμιότυπου οθόνης
Εικόνα στιγμιότυπου οθόνης
Εικόνα στιγμιότυπου οθόνης
Εικόνα στιγμιότυπου οθόνης
Εικόνα στιγμιότυπου οθόνης

Περιγραφή εφαρμογής

Το Dart είναι μια γλώσσα προγραμματισμού ανοιχτού κώδικα, αντικειμενοστραφής, βασισμένη στην τάξη, με έμφαση στην απλότητα, την παραγωγικότητα και την απόδοση. Δημιουργήθηκε για να αντιμετωπίσει τις προκλήσεις της σύγχρονης ανάπτυξης εφαρμογών, προσφέροντας ένα ισχυρό σύνολο εργαλείων και δυνατοτήτων για προγραμματιστές. Το Dart είναι γνωστό για τη γρήγορη ταχύτητα εκτέλεσης του, γεγονός που το καθιστά κατάλληλο για ανάπτυξη τόσο από την πλευρά του πελάτη όσο και από την πλευρά του διακομιστή.

Τα βασικά χαρακτηριστικά του Dart περιλαμβάνουν:

Έντονη πληκτρολόγηση: Το Dart είναι μια στατικά πληκτρολογημένη γλώσσα, πράγμα που σημαίνει ότι οι τύποι μεταβλητών καθορίζονται κατά το χρόνο μεταγλώττισης, βοηθώντας στη σύλληψη σφαλμάτων νωρίς στη διαδικασία ανάπτυξης.

Αντικειμενοστραφή: Το Dart ακολουθεί αντικειμενοστρεφείς αρχές προγραμματισμού, επιτρέποντας στους προγραμματιστές να δημιουργήσουν επαναχρησιμοποιήσιμο, αρθρωτό κώδικα μέσω κλάσεων και αντικειμένων.

Συνοπτική σύνταξη: Η σύνταξη του Dart έχει σχεδιαστεί για να είναι εύκολη στην ανάγνωση και τη γραφή, μειώνοντας τον κώδικα του boilerplate και βελτιώνοντας την παραγωγικότητα των προγραμματιστών.

Ασύγχρονος προγραμματισμός: Το Dart παρέχει ενσωματωμένη υποστήριξη για ασύγχρονο προγραμματισμό μέσω λειτουργιών όπως το async/wait, καθιστώντας το κατάλληλο για τον αποτελεσματικό χειρισμό εργασιών όπως αιτήματα δικτύου και λειτουργίες I/O.

Cross-Platform: Το Dart μπορεί να χρησιμοποιηθεί για την ανάπτυξη εφαρμογών πολλαπλών πλατφορμών, χάρη σε πλαίσια όπως το Flutter, το οποίο σας επιτρέπει να δημιουργείτε εγγενώς μεταγλωττισμένες εφαρμογές για κινητά, ιστό και επιτραπέζιους υπολογιστές από μια ενιαία βάση κώδικα.

DartVM και JIT/AOT Compilation: Οι εφαρμογές Dart μπορούν να εκτελεστούν στο Dart Virtual Machine (DartVM) για σκοπούς ανάπτυξης και μπορούν να μεταγλωττιστούν σε εγγενή κώδικα χρησιμοποιώντας Just-In-Time (JIT) ή Ahead-Of-Time (AOT) για ανάπτυξη παραγωγής.

Rich Standard Library: Το Dart συνοδεύεται από μια ολοκληρωμένη τυπική βιβλιοθήκη που περιλαμβάνει συλλογές, λειτουργίες I/O και άλλα βοηθητικά προγράμματα για τη βελτιστοποίηση της ανάπτυξης εφαρμογών.

Κοινότητα και οικοσύστημα: Το Dart έχει μια αυξανόμενη κοινότητα προγραμματιστών και ένα διευρυνόμενο οικοσύστημα πακέτων και βιβλιοθηκών που διατίθενται μέσω του Dart Package Manager (pub.dev).

Συνολικά, το Dart είναι μια ευέλικτη γλώσσα προγραμματισμού με μεγάλη εστίαση στο να επιτρέπει στους προγραμματιστές να δημιουργούν εύκολα εφαρμογές υψηλής απόδοσης, συντηρήσιμες και πολλαπλών πλατφορμών. Η πιο αξιοσημείωτη περίπτωση χρήσης του είναι σε συνδυασμό με το πλαίσιο Flutter για τη δημιουργία οπτικά ελκυστικών και ανταποκρινόμενων διεπαφών χρήστη σε διαφορετικές πλατφόρμες.
Ενημερώθηκε στις
10 Σεπ 2023

Ασφάλεια δεδομένων

Η ασφάλειά σας ξεκινά από την κατανόηση του τρόπου με τον οποίο οι προγραμματιστές συλλέγουν και κοινοποιούν τα δεδομένα σας. Οι πρακτικές απορρήτου και ασφάλειας δεδομένων μπορεί να διαφέρουν ανάλογα με τη χρήση, την περιοχή και την ηλικία σας. Αυτές οι πληροφορίες παρέχονται από τον προγραμματιστή και ενδέχεται να ενημερωθούν με την πάροδο του χρόνου.
Δεν κοινοποιούνται δεδομένα σε τρίτα μέρη
Μάθετε περισσότερα σχετικά με τον τρόπο δήλωσης κοινοποίησης από τους προγραμματιστές
Δεν συλλέχθηκαν δεδομένα
Μάθετε περισσότερα σχετικά με τον τρόπο δήλωσης συλλογής από τους προγραμματιστές